While many banks set their prime rate according to the federal funds rate, there’s no universal prime rate. When you see a reference to “the prime rate,” it usually reflects an average rate across financial institutions. The fed funds rate is the overnight rate banks and other financial institutions use to lend money to each other. The process is a constant electronic flow of money that ensures that each bank has sufficient liquidity to operate from day to day.

It’s usually the lowest interest rate banks will charge and is a benchmark to determine interest rates for other products, like lines of credit, credit cards and small business loans. Any existing loan or line of credit that has a fixed interest rate is not affected by a change in the prime rate. This includes any student loans, mortgages, savings accounts, and credit cards that are issued with fixed rates rather than variable rates. The federal funds rate is the rate banks charge each other for short-term loans. Banks use this rate as a starting point to set the prime rate for consumers. The prime rate is often roughly 3% higher than the federal funds rate (and currently 3.25%).

While the interest rate on most financial products is dependent on the prime rate, the actual rate you receive is rarely the same exact amount. Typically, your interest rate is above the prime rate, but the amount can be greater depending on the lender. For instance, the average credit card APR on accounts assessed interest is currently 15.78% — the prime rate plus 12.53%. “Decisions by a bank’s asset and liability committee will ultimately determine where those other rates will settle,” says Garretty. For example, if one bank wants more credit card business on their books while another does not, they will quote different credit card rates, even though they are working off the same prime rate.

The prime rate began to rise significantly in the 1970s as the United States experienced an economic recession and high inflation. The prime rate reached its all-time high of 21.5% in Dec. 1980, as the Federal Reserve sought to curb inflation by raising interest rates. The relationship between the prime rate and federal funds rate

Once a bank changes its prime rate based on the new federal funds rate, it will then start adjusting rates for many of its other lending products in the same direction. And when the federal funds rate and prime rate go down, other rates fall too, making it less expensive to borrow. Since individual consumers do not have the same resources, banks typically charge them the prime rate plus a surcharge based on the product type they want.
